Skip to main content

A Triangular Formation Strategy for Collective Behaviors of Robot Swarm

  • Conference paper
Computational Science and Its Applications – ICCSA 2009 (ICCSA 2009)

Part of the book series: Lecture Notes in Computer Science ((LNTCS,volume 5592))

Included in the following conference series:

Abstract

This paper presents, a novel decentralized control strategy, named Triangular Formation Algorithm (TFA), for a swarm of simple robots. The TFA is a local interaction strategy which basically makes three neighboring robots to form a regular triangular lattice. This strategy requires minimal conditions for robots and it can be easily realized with real robots. The TFA is executed by every member of the swarm asynchronously. For swarm obstacle avoidance, a simplified artificial physical model is introduced to work with the TFA. Simulation results showed that the global behaviors of swarm such as aggregation, flocking and obstacle avoidance in an unknown environment can be achieved using the TFA and obstacle avoidance mechanism.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 84.99
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 109.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. Bayindir, L., Şahin, E.: A review of studies in swarm robotics. Turk. J. Elec. Engin. 15(2), 115–147 (2007)

    Google Scholar 

  2. Şahin, E.: Swarm robotics: from sources of inspiration to domains of application. In: Şahin, E., Spears, W.M. (eds.) Swarm Robotics 2004. LNCS, vol. 3342, pp. 10–20. Springer, Heidelberg (2005)

    Chapter  Google Scholar 

  3. Schmickl, T., Möslinger, C., Crailsheim, K.: Collective perception in a robot swarm. In: Şahin, E., Spears, W.M., Winfield, A.F.T. (eds.) SAB 2006 Ws 2007. LNCS, vol. 4433, pp. 144–157. Springer, Heidelberg (2007)

    Chapter  Google Scholar 

  4. Shaw, E.: The schooling of fishes. Sci. Am. 206, 128–138 (1962)

    Article  Google Scholar 

  5. Reynolds, C.W.: Flocks, herds, and schools: a distributed behavioral model. Computer Graphics 21(4), 25–34 (1987)

    Article  Google Scholar 

  6. Correll, N., Cianci, C., Raemy, X., Martinoli, A.: Self-organized embedded sensor/actuator networks for “smart” turbines”. In: The IEEE/RSJ International Conference on Intelligent Robots and Systems Workshop on Network Robot System: Toward intelligent robotic systems integrated with environments, IEEE Press, Los Alamitos (2006)

    Google Scholar 

  7. Chong, C.Y., Kumar, S.P.: Sensor networks: evolution, opportunities, and challenges. Proceedings of the IEEE 91(8), 1247–1256 (2003)

    Article  Google Scholar 

  8. Godwin, M.F., Spry, S.C., Hedrick, J.K.: Distributed system for collaboration and control of UAV groups: experiments and analysis. In: Grundel, D., Murphey, R., Pardalos, P., Prokopyev, O. (eds.) Cooperative Systems. LNEMS, vol. 588, pp. 139–156. Springer, Heidelberg (2007)

    Chapter  Google Scholar 

  9. Gustafson, E.H., Lollini, C.T., Bishop, B.E., Wick, C.E.: Swarm technology for search and rescue through multi-sensor multi-viewpoint target identification. In: The 37th Southeastern Symposium on System Theory, pp. 352–356. IEEE Press, Los Alamitos (2005)

    Google Scholar 

  10. Bahceci, E., Soysal, O., Sahin, E.: A review: pattern formation and adaptation in multi-robot systems. Technical Report CMU-RI-TR-03-43, Carnegie Mellon University, Pittsburgh, PA, USA (2003)

    Google Scholar 

  11. Egerstedt, M., Hu, X.: Formation constrained multi-agent control. IEEE Transaction on Robotics and Automation 17(6), 947–951 (2001)

    Article  Google Scholar 

  12. Koo, T.J., Shahruz, S.M.: Formation of a group of unmanned aerial vehicles. In: The American Control Conference (ACC), vol. 1, pp. 69–74. IEEE Press, Los Alamitos (2001)

    Google Scholar 

  13. Balch, T., Hybinette, M.: Behavior-based coordination of large scale robot formations. In: The 4th International Conference on Multiagent Systems (ICMAS), pp. 363–364. IEEE Press, Los Alamitos (2000)

    Chapter  Google Scholar 

  14. Balch, T., Hybinette, M.: Social potentials for scalable multi-robot formations. In: The IEEE International Conference on Robotics and Automation (ICRA), vol. 1, pp. 73–80. IEEE Press, Los Alamitos (2000)

    Google Scholar 

  15. Baras, J.S., Tan, X., Hovareshti, P.: Decentralized control of autonomous vehicles. In: 42nd IEEE Conference on Decision and Control, pp. 1532–1537. IEEE Press, Los Alamitos (2003)

    Google Scholar 

  16. Kim, D.H., Wang, H., Shin, S.: Decentralized control of autonomous swarm systems using artificial potential function-analytical design guidelines. J. Intell. Robot Syst. 45, 36–394 (2006)

    Article  Google Scholar 

  17. Spears, W.M., Spears, D.F., Heil, R., Kerr, W., Hettiarachchi, S.: An overview of physicomimetics. In: Şahin, E., Spears, W.M. (eds.) Swarm Robotics 2004. LNCS, vol. 3342, pp. 84–97. Springer, Heidelberg (2005)

    Chapter  Google Scholar 

  18. Spears, W., Spears, D., Hamann, J., Heil, R.: Distributed, physics-based control of swarms of vehicles. Autonomous Robots 17, 137–162 (2004)

    Article  Google Scholar 

  19. Shucker, B., Bennett, J.K.: Scalable Control of Distributed Robotic Macrosensors. In: The 7th International Symposium on Distributed Autonomous Robotic Systems (DARS 2004). IEEE Press, Los Alamitos (2004)

    Google Scholar 

  20. Shucker, B., Bennett, J.K.: Virtual Spring Mesh Algorithms for Control of Distributed Robotic Macrosensors. Technical report CU-CS-996-05, Department of Computer Science, University of Colorado at Boulder (2005)

    Google Scholar 

  21. Lee, G., Chong, N.Y.: Decentralized formation control for a team of anonymous mobile robots. In: The 6th Asian Control Conference, pp. 971–976. IEEE Press, Los Alamitos (2006)

    Google Scholar 

  22. Lee, G., Chong, N.Y.: Flocking controls for swarms of mobile robots inspired by fish schools. In: Lazinica, A. (ed.) Recent advances in multi robot systems, I-Tech Education and Publishing, Vienna, Austria (2008)

    Google Scholar 

  23. Klein, J.: Breve: a 3D simulation environment for the simulation of decentralized systems and artificial life. In: Artificial Life VIII, the 8th International Conference on the Simulation and Synthesis of Living Systems, MIT Press, Cambridge (2002), http://www.spiderland.org/breve

    Google Scholar 

  24. Yang, Y., Xiong, N., Chong, N.Y., Défago, X.: A decentralized and adaptive flocking algorithm for autonomous mobile robots. In: The 3rd International Conference on Grid and Pervasive Computing Workshops, pp. 262–268. IEEE Press, Los Alamitos (2008)

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2009 Springer-Verlag Berlin Heidelberg

About this paper

Cite this paper

Li, X., Ercan, M.F., Fung, Y.F. (2009). A Triangular Formation Strategy for Collective Behaviors of Robot Swarm. In: Gervasi, O., Taniar, D., Murgante, B., Laganà, A., Mun, Y., Gavrilova, M.L. (eds) Computational Science and Its Applications – ICCSA 2009. ICCSA 2009. Lecture Notes in Computer Science, vol 5592.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-642-02454-2_70

Download citation

  • DOI: https://doi.org/10.1007/978-3-642-02454-2_70

  • Publisher Name: Springer, Berlin, Heidelberg

  • Print ISBN: 978-3-642-02453-5

  • Online ISBN: 978-3-642-02454-2

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ics